body,html{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000000;
	line-height:22px;
	
}
body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
}

a{
text-decoration:none;
color:#000000;}

ul{
list-style-type:none;
margin:0px;
padding:0px;}

.links A {
	COLOR: #FFFFFF; FONT: 14px verdana; TEXT-DECORATION: none; font-weight:bold;
}

.links A:link {
	COLOR: #FFFFFF; FONT: 14px verdana; TEXT-DECORATION: none; font-weight:bold;
}
.links A:visited {
	COLOR: #FFFFFF; FONT: 14px verdana; TEXT-DECORATION: none;
}
.links A:active {
	TEXT-DECORATION: none;
}
.links A:hover {
	COLOR: #FF6600; TEXT-DECORATION: none; font-weight:bold;
}

#header{
width:1004px;
height:268px;
margin:0 auto;
}
#header_index{
width:1004px;
height:320px;
margin:0 auto;
}
#main{
width:1004px;
margin:0 auto;
padding:0px;}
div{
padding:0px;
margin:0px;}
.divfloat{
float:left;}
.left{
width:228px;

}
.right{
width:775px;
}

.index_news{
width:100%;
float:left;}

.index_news li{
float:left;
height:25px;
line-height:25px;
border-bottom:1px solid #CCCCCC;}

.index_news_li{
LINE-HEIGHT: 25px;  DISPLAY: block; BACKGROUND: url(../images/news1.jpg) no-repeat left center; HEIGHT: 25px;
}

.menu{
margin:0px;
padding:0px;
width:100%;
}

.menu li{
height:30px;
font-size:12px;
line-height:32px;
margin:auto;
width:94%;
text-indent:1em;
}
.menu :hover {
	COLOR: #FF6600; TEXT-DECORATION: none;
}
.menu span{
padding-left:5px;}

.menu A{
	LINE-HEIGHT: 30px;  DISPLAY: block; BACKGROUND: url(../images/leftbiao.gif) no-repeat left center; HEIGHT: 30px; CURSOR: pointer; color:#FFFFFF; 
}
.menu a:hover {
	COLOR: #FF6600; TEXT-DECORATION: none;
}


.menu_2{
background-image:url(../images/company_04.jpg);
}


.menu_2_1 A{LINE-HEIGHT: 22px;  DISPLAY: block; BACKGROUND: url(../gb/images/leftbiao.jpg) no-repeat left center; HEIGHT: 22px; CURSOR: pointer;}

.menu_2_1_1 A{
}

.productsearch{
width:213px;
margin:auto;}
.searchtext{
padding-top:15px;
width:213px;
background-image:url(../images/meber_02.jpg);
height:50px;
margin:auto;}
.searchtext li{
margin-left:8px;
float:left;
}
.searchtext img{
vertical-align:middle;}

.login{
width:213px;
margin:auto;

}
.loginleft{

margin:10px 0 0 10px;
width:60%;
}
.loginleft li{
margin-top:2px;
line-height:20px;}
.loginright{
float:right;
width:30%;
margin:5px 0px 0 0;}
.textinput{
height:13px;
width:70px;}
.vcode{
width:93%;
margin:0 auto;
}
.vcode li{
width:50%;
float:left;
text-align:left;}
.vcode img{
vertical-align:middle;}
.text{
font-size:12px;
text-align:right;}
.reger{
overflow:hidden;
width:99%;
margin:0 auto;}
.reger li{
height:21px;
margin-top:3px;
line-height:20px;
width:48%;
text-align:center;
float:left;
}
.reger a{
text-decoration:none;
color:#000000;}

.product_title{
background-image:url(../images/product.jpg);
width:730px;
height:36px;}


.cpdetail{
border-bottom:1px #CCCCCC dotted;
border-top:1px #CCCCCC dotted;
}


.product_title li{
line-height:36px;
text-align:right;
font-size:12px;
padding-right:20px;}

.news_title{
background-image:url(../images/news.jpg);
width:730px;
height:36px;}

.news_title li{
line-height:36px;
text-align:right;
font-size:12px;
padding-right:20px;}


.news_detail{
width:98%;
margin:auto;
padding-top:10px;
}


.quick{
width:84%;
margin:4px auto;
}
#footer{
width:1003px;
margin:auto;
height:79px;
clear:both;
overflow:hidden;
}
.footerlogo{
width:227px;
height:76px;}

.copyRight{
padding-top:10px;
font-size:12px;
background-image:url(../images/company_10.jpg);
width:774px;
height:76px;

}
.copyRight li{
width:90%;
margin:auto;
height:18px;

}

.copyRight a{
text-decoration:none;
color:#000000;}

.spe_product{
float:left;
margin:auto;
margin-top:20px;
margin-left:14px;
display:inline;
width:228px;
}
.spe_product img{
width:224px;
height:168px;
}
.spe_productpic{
width:224px;
height:168px;
margin:auto;}

.spe_productname{
line-height:25px;
height:25px;
margin:auto;
width:220px;
text-align:left;}

.product_list{
width:98%;
margin:auto;
}

.spe_page{
margin:auto;
width:98%;
line-height:40px;
height:60px;
text-align:right;
clear:both;}

.product_detail{
width:98%;
margin:auto;
padding-top:60px;
}
.product_maximages{
margin-left:25px;
width:350px;

text-align:center;
}
.Parameters{
width:360px;


}
.Parameters li{
margin-top:5px;
height:25px;
line-height:25px;
font-size:12px;}
.Description{
width:98%;
margin:auto;
word-wrap:break-word;
word-break : break-all; 
clear:both;
}
.product_detail_color dd{
float:left;
margin-left:25px;}
.product_detail_color img{
width:65px;
border:1px solid #CCCCCC;
height:30px;}
.product_detail_color a:hover{
border:1px #009933 solid;}